How to Use

Usage Instructions

Map out your fence placement to decide where the posts will be placed and how the fence will be set around the area.

Position the fence feet and the anchor bases, so that you can easily set up your panels.

Once the fence base is in the correct position, you can begin placing your chain-link panels by positioning the posts into the fence base holes.

Use a drill to install the metal fence couplers that secure the panels together.

Add accessories such as gates for access into the area and wheel kits to allow for easier mobility.

If privacy is needed, install custom fence covers or privacy screens to limit visibility into the secured area.

Cautions for Use

Regularly inspect the fence for any damage. Construction sites are constantly changing, and it’s essential to regularly check the fence for any damage or wear and tear. This includes checking for loose panels, missing bolts, or any other potential hazards.

Consider adding top rails for extra stability. If your construction site is located in a windy area, adding top rails to your temporary fence can provide extra stability and prevent it from falling over.

Have a plan for emergencies. Accidents can happen, and it’s essential to have a plan in place for emergency situations. Make sure everyone on the site knows how to react in case of an emergency involving the temporary fence.

Manufacturing Process

Weaving: The wire is fed through a machine that weaves it into a spiral pattern. The spiral is then cut and pressed flat, and the fence is moved up for the next cycle. 
Attaching mesh: The chain link mesh is stretched over the fence panel frame and attached with metal tie wires. 
Adding tension bars: The mesh is attached to vertical tension bars on the left and right sides of the panel. Metal tension bands secure the tension bars to the panel's vertical rails. 
Cutting and attaching panels: The chain link is cut into panels and attached to posts with bolts or clips.
